Advanced Flexible Composites Inc is an EPA Toxics Release Inventory reporter in Lake In The Hills, IL, in the plastics and rubber sector. It reported 7.7K lbs of releases across 3 chemicals in 2023, and 43.3K lbs in total across its 2019-2023 reporting years. That ranks 6,448 of 25,986 TRI facilities nationwide by cumulative reported pounds, counting each facility over however many years it has filed. In Illinois's 951 reporting TRI sites, pounds #1 is not chemical-count #1. Advanced Flexible Composites Inc is pounds #261 and chemical-count #396 at 43.3K lbs. Prairie State Generating Co leads reported pounds (37.9M lbs) at 31 chemicals (chemical-count #8). Veolia N.a. Inc. leads chemical count at 141 chemicals (1.9M lbs, pounds #34). Reported volume fell against 2022. Pounds reported are not a measure of toxicity or health risk. Emissions Trend Summary

From 2019 to 2023, total releases decreased by 36% (12.1K lbs to 7.7K lbs).

Chemical Releases

Aggregated across all reporting years (2019–2023). 1 of 3 chemicals are carcinogens. Sorted by total release volume.

Chemical Total Flags
Xylene (mixed isomers) 25.2K lbs -
Toluene 11.0K lbs -
Ethylbenzene 7.1K lbs Carcinogen
